Had hopeful hopes this moring. The birds had squid on the outside and nothing but bait readings on the inside. I would head to the island instead of San Antonio tomorrow. I don't believe that winter buoy reports accurately portray your weather to the island in the morning.  Just expect to assign a driver to point you into the swell and surf your way home afterwards. The fish should be biting at some point during the morning. Just don't expect a bluebird glass calm day this week. Who knows if the bite will be hot? If you're going to bottomfish, don't waste you time, and hit the reef.

    Glad to see some people getting some yellows. Went out early on Friday and got blown off water buy about noon. Wind came up earlier on Friday than Thursday. Both days really windy with UGLY seas. Got some hits at the reef bottom fishing on cut squid and sardina. Broke off a few large fish but couldnt get them in the boat. Fishing in 350 feet of water 5-6 miles out.Its a lot of work fishing that deep in big seas. Decided to cut my losses and head home early.
